Keeping Up With Tradition Valentines Day Gifts

Three of the most typical traditional Valentine’s Day gifts are cards, flowers and chocolate. Although jewellery is another common and well loved Valentine’s gift nowadays, it is these first three that go back centuries and are still popular today. Valentine’s cards were given as early as the 15th century, when Charles the Duke of Orleans wrote a poem for his wife on Valentine’s Day when he was imprisoned in the Tower of London. This started a tradition of sending cards which grew in popularity in the 16th century and became extremely common practice from the 19th century onwards, when mass produced greetings cards started to be sent.
